SSL服务器证书:保障网站数据传输安全的关键(ssl服务器需要客户端证书)


SSL服务器证书:保障网站数据传输安全的关键(需要客户端证书)

SSL服务器证书

一、引言

随着互联网技术的不断发展,网络安全问题日益突出。
保护网站数据传输安全成为一项至关重要的任务。
SSL服务器证书作为一种有效的安全解决方案,广泛应用于网站安全领域,为数据传输提供加密保障。
本文将详细介绍SSL服务器证书的作用、重要性以及为何需要客户端证书,同时阐述其工作原理、安装流程和相关注意事项。

二、SSL服务器证书的作用与重要性

1. 作用

SSL服务器证书是一种数字证书,用于在服务器与客户端之间建立安全的通信通道。
它通过加密技术,确保网站数据传输过程中的信息安全,防止数据被窃取或篡改。
SSL证书还能确认服务器的身份,防止用户访问到假冒的钓鱼网站或被恶意攻击。

ssl服务器需要客户端证书

2. 重要性

随着互联网应用的普及,人们对于网络安全的要求越来越高。
网站数据的传输安全直接关系到用户的隐私安全、企业的商业机密以及国家的安全利益。
因此,部署SSL服务器证书对于保障网站数据传输安全具有重要意义。
SSL证书还能提升网站的信誉度和用户体验,有助于企业在竞争激烈的市场中脱颖而出。

三、SSL服务器证书的工作原理

SSL服务器证书的工作原理主要基于公钥基础设施(PKI)和对称加密技术。
在服务器部署SSL证书后,服务器与客户端之间的通信将受到加密保护。
具体过程如下:

1. 客户端向服务器发起请求;
2. 服务器返回数字证书,其中包含公钥;
3. 客户端验证数字证书的真实性;
4. 验证通过后,客户端生成随机对称密钥;
5. 客户端将对称密钥通过服务器的公钥进行加密传输;
6. 服务器使用私钥解密对称密钥,并建立安全通道;
7. 双方通过安全通道进行数据传输。

四、为何需要客户端证书

在SSL服务器证书的基础上,部分场景还需要使用客户端证书。
客户端证书的作用是对客户端进行身份认证,确保只有合法的客户端才能与服务器进行通信。
这对于防止非法访问、保护敏感信息具有重要意义。
例如,在一些企业级应用中,为了防止内部资料泄露,需要对访问系统的客户端进行身份验证,这时就需要使用客户端证书。

五、SSL服务器证书的安装流程

1. 生成密钥文件:在服务器上生成私钥和公钥;
2. 申请证书:通过证书签发机构(CA)申请SSL证书;
3. 配置服务器:将证书、密钥文件配置到服务器上;
4. 验证配置:验证服务器配置是否正确;
5. 测试安全性:测试服务器的安全性,确保SSL证书生效。

六、注意事项

1. 选择可信赖的证书签发机构(CA);
2. 确保证书的合法性,避免遭受中间人攻击;
3. 定期更新证书,避免过期导致的安全问题;
4. 注意保护私钥的安全,避免私钥泄露;
5. 在使用客户端证书时,确保客户端证书的妥善管理,避免证书滥用。

七、总结

SSL服务器证书是保障网站数据传输安全的关键。
通过部署SSL服务器证书,可以为网站提供加密保障,防止数据被窃取或篡改。
同时,为了进一步提高安全性,部分场景还需要使用客户端证书对客户端进行身份认证。
在使用过程中,需要注意选择可信赖的证书签发机构、确保证书的合法性、定期更新证书以及保护私钥的安全。


收藏

推荐阅读:


扫描二维码,在手机上阅读

服务器证书的类型与选择:适用于不同场景的需求解析(服务器证书的作用)

服务器证书的生命周期管理:从申请到续期的全攻略(服务器证书的作用)

评 论
请登录后再评论